So - search or browse through the Canada forum, there's a few threads where people have discussed the prices they paid. Lately, it seems that some people have been able to get a couple of thousand off MSRP. Many of us who bought last year, though, happily paid full MSRP (me included). I don't know what supply of the 04s is going to be like through the summer - I recall someone saying they were told the last of the 04s were coming now (ie May), and then there won't be any more Canadian RX-8s available until the 05s arrive. Does your dealer have a few sitting on the lot? Would you accept a different colour for a better price? (ie how flexible are you?) Is it worth paying a bit more to be driving it through the summer vs. trying to get a better deal on an 05?

I think you can/should do better than that with 7 on the lot. The dealer invoice for the car is about $36,500. I would bring them down to at least $38K even especially if you are going to add options. I would get a discount on those also for at least 20%.
Play hardball man! You are the client....make them squirm!
Worst case...walk out. I have done it dozens of times and they have always come back to me...and then I made them take more money off (or throw something in) just cause they already turned down my last offer.
hey with 7. They want them off the lot fast.
